Rob Labritz has missed out on a PGA Tour Champions card for next season by two spots. He will have to go through Q-School to regain his card for the next year. Labritz is a Glen Arbor Golf Club pro and earned his PGA Tour Champions card through Q-School.

The 53-year-old was left disheartened and expressed his pain in a candid interview. Golf Monthly shared a quote from his interview highlighting his pain with a caption:

"What. It. Means. A heartbroken Rob Labritz gave a candid interview through tears after agonizingly losing his PGA Tour Champions card."
"I've got nothing to say. I played my a** off this year and played really crappy... You have to come out here and be firing on all cylinders because you will get swallowed alive. Unfortunately, I got swallowed alive," Labritz said.

The 53-year-old golfer revealed he missed an event due to a back injury and said you cannot expect to play well injured.

"I just had to miss an event due to my back injury, and, you know, there it is. You cannot expect to come out here and play well injured," Labritz said.

He then revealed if he would compete on the PGA Tour Champions again or take a bit of a break from the game.

"I don't know. I don't know. I'll figure it out. Q-School, maybe. I don't know. I got a lot of thinking to do, and... My game is getting better, but, unfortunately, it's not... I don't know what to say."

How did Rob Labritz perform on the 2024 PGA Tour Champions?

Rob Labritz gave his best throughout the season, but unfortunately couldn't make it to the playoffs and retain his PGA Tour Champions card. He missed this opportunity by a whisker as he finished 74th in the Charles Schwab Cup rankings while only the top 72 golfers made it to the final three events for the Schwab Cup playoffs.

"Yeah, I know I can win out here - that's what sucks. And I don't get another opportunity to do it unless I get through Q-School again. So, yeah, I'm hurting right now. As high as I was when I won Q-School, I'm as low as that now," Labritz said during the same interview.

Labritz competed in the 23 events this season and made 22 cuts but, unfortunately, he never finished in the top 10. His best finish was 21 at the US Senior Open Championship, and he eventually had just four top-25 finishes.

Hence, despite playing consistent golf, he missed out on retaining his Senior Tour card for the next season due to no top five or top 10 finishes in the entire season.
